The Math Behind Voltage and Wattage

Here's the simple formula every DIY enthusiast should know:

  • Power (Watts) = Voltage × Current
  • A 24V inverter running at 400W draws about 16.7A (400 ÷ 24)

Choosing the Right Inverter

Not all 24V inverters are created equal. Look for:

  • ≥90% efficiency rating
  • Surge capacity for motor startups
  • Overload protection

Pro Tip: Pair your inverter with properly sized cables. We've seen 30% efficiency drops from using undersized wiring!

FAQ: Your Burning Questions Answered

  • Q: Will a 400W microwave work?A: Only if the inverter has 800W+ surge capacity
  • Q: How many batteries do I need?A: For 8-hour runtime: 400W ÷ 24V × 8h = 133Ah
